APP便捷了每个人的生活,APP开发让每个企业都开始了移动信息化进程
一、AR换脸软件的开发背景
随着社交媒体的普及,人们对于个人形象的关注度越来越高。尤其是在短平台上,许多人都希望通过来美化自己的形象。传统的技术往往需要的技能和设备,这使得很多人无法享受这种技术带来的乐趣。AR换脸软件的开发为人们提供了一种简单易用的解决方案。
二、AR换脸软件的技术原理
AR换脸软件的技术原理主要是基于增强现实技术和计算视觉技术。通过计算视觉技术对输入的图像进行人脸检测和识别,获取人脸的位置和特征点信息。利用增强现实技术将虚拟的脸部图像与输入的图像进行合成,生成Zui终的换脸效果。
具体来说,AR换脸软件需要实现以下几个关键技术:
1.人脸检测和识别:通过计算视觉技术对输入的图像进行人脸检测和识别,获取人脸的位置和特征点信息。这是实现AR换脸软件的基础。
2.虚拟脸部图像生成:根据获取的人脸特征点信息,生成对应的虚拟脸部图像。这个过程需要考虑到光照、表情、角度等因素的影响,以确保生成的虚拟脸部图像与输入图像能够自然地融合在一起。
3.图像合成:将生成的虚拟脸部图像与输入的图像进行合成,生成Zui终的换脸效果。这个过程需要考虑光照、角度、遮挡等因素的影响,以确保合成的效果自然、真实。
4.实时跟踪和动态捕捉:为了实现更加自然的换脸效果,AR换脸软件需要实现实时跟踪和动态捕捉功能。这需要利用计算视觉技术和运动跟踪技术,对人脸部表情和动作进行实时跟踪和捕捉,以实现更加自然的换脸效果。
APP便捷了每个人的生活,APP开发让每个企业都开始了移动信息化进程APP便捷了每个人的生活,APP开发让每个企业都开始了移动信息化进程APP便捷了每个人的生活,APP开发让每个企业都开始了移动信息化进程APP商业模式APP开发让每个企业都开始了移动信息化进程APP商业模式APP开发让每个企业都开始了移动信息化进程APP商业模式APP开发让每个企业都开始了移动信息化进程APP商业模式APP开发让每个企业都开始了移动信息化进程